How the Spanish year is shaped

Spring is the heaviest stretch of the traditional calendar: Holy Week processions move through towns across the country in the run-up to Easter, and the fair and pilgrimage season follows immediately behind it in Andalusia. Because it is pegged to Easter it moves every year, so check dates before assuming a March or April trip lands on it.

Summer pushes almost everything outdoors. Open-air music, town fiestas and night markets take over from roughly June to early September, and in the hottest inland cities the programme genuinely starts late — concerts at ten in the evening are normal, not a novelty.

Autumn is when the indoor season restarts. Theatres, concert halls and auditoriums publish their programmes in September and run hard through to Christmas, which is why the deepest listings on this page in October and November are cultural rather than festival dates.

December is its own season, opening with the public-holiday bridge in the first week and closing on 6 January with the Three Kings. Between those two points every sizeable Spanish town runs lights, nativity displays and a holiday programme.

Planning around a Spanish event

  • Spanish evenings start late. Doors at 21:00 or 22:00 are ordinary, and clubs and late venues run well past what most of Europe treats as closing time.
  • The big travel crunches are Holy Week, the first week of August and the stretch from 22 December to 6 January — book trains and beds weeks ahead for those.
  • Long-distance high-speed rail links Madrid to Barcelona, Seville, Córdoba, Málaga and Valencia, so pairing two cities around one event is usually easier than flying between them.
  • Many cities close their historic centres to traffic for major fiestas. If you are driving, check where you can actually park before the day.
  • August empties the big cities of residents and fills the coast. If you want a Spanish city at its most local, September is a better month than August.

Which Spanish city has the most events?
Madrid, by a wide margin. It runs the biggest theatre, comedy and live-music programme in the country and does so all year. Barcelona is second, with Seville leading the rest.
When is the busiest time of year for events in Spain?
Two peaks. Spring, around Holy Week and the Andalusian fair season, and then summer, when the open-air programme and town fiestas run from June into early September. The indoor cultural season restarts in September and runs to Christmas.
How far ahead should I book?
For anything landing in Holy Week, the first week of August, or between 22 December and 6 January, book transport and accommodation several weeks out. Outside those windows most Spanish cities absorb visitors comfortably.
